Shootout leaves 1 man dead, another critically wounded

Gunfire erupts in 8000 block of Trail Village near FM 78

SAN ANTONIO – One man was killed and another man was critically wounded in a shooting early Tuesday in east Bexar County.

Sgt. Raymond Pollard of the Bexar County Sheriff's Office Homicide Unit said the shooting occurred in the 8000 block of Trail Village near FM 78 around 2:30 a.m. Tuesday moments after a 41-year-old man left his home to go to the store to get food for his family.

"When he backed out there was (a) confrontation with these three other individuals. He drove back to the house and proceeded to get a weapon, and apparently these other individuals who were walking down the street also had weapons," Pollard said.

Deputies at the scene said they believe the man who died fired the gunshots that left a 26-year-old man with four wounds. He was transported to San Antonio Military Medical Center in critical condition.

Deputies recovered a gun next to the man who died. A second weapon was found a small distance from the scene.

John Cooper awoke to the sound of gunfire and ran outside to find two men lying on the ground.

"You want to render aid, but then again, when you hear shots, you got to be safe about it. I saw another individual by the gentleman lying down," Cooper said.

At first, Cooper didn't recognize his 41-year-old neighbor who he described as a hard worker who provided for his family.

Deputies are working to determine who the actual victim is in the case. They're also looking for a third individual who may have been involved in the shooting.

They are also talking to witnesses and conducting interviews trying to figure out if others were involved.
